The style of devices from the Microsoft Surface Laptop series has crystallized over the last three generations so that in the fourth installment. It does not change externally almost at all. However, changes took place in the interior, so we can safely say that the Surface Laptop 4 is the best conventional notebook from the Surface family that has been created so far.

This year, Microsoft – for the first time since the offer of the giant from Redmond includes Surface Laptop notebooks – decided to present editions with AMD Ryzen processors in their “little ones.” Until now, Ryzeny was available in larger options with a 15-inch screen, but 13.5-inch screens were only available with Intel processors. This time, AMD systems also appeared in configurations assigned to devices with a smaller screen diagonal. While this is a curiosity, we will look at the “traditional” version – with a 13.5 “screen and an Intel Core i5-1135G7 processor (2.4 GHz).

Technical Specification

  • Display – 13.5 inch PixelSense display, Resolution: 2256 x 1504 (201 PPI), Aspect ratio: 3: 2, Surface pen support, 10-point multi-touch,
  • Memory – 8 GB of RAM LPDDR4x,
  • Processor – 11th generation Intel Core i5-1135G7 quad-core processor,
  • Graphics card – Intel Iris Xe,
  • Disk space – 512 GB,
  • Connectors – 1 × USB-C port, 1 × USB-A port, 3.5 mm headphone jack, 1 × Surface Connect port,
  • Security  – TPM 2.0 chip for enterprise security and BitLocker support, Enterprise security with facial login with Windows Hello,
  • Cameras, video, and sound – Camera (front) 720p HD f / 2.0, Two long-range studio microphones, Omnisonic speakers with Dolby Atmos 7 technology,
  • Wireless communication – Wi-Fi 6: compatible with 802.11ax, Bluetooth 5.0,
  • Sensors – Ambient light sensor,
  • Declared battery life – Up to 17 hours 
    battery life (with a typical device load),
  • Battery capacity – Nominal battery capacity (Wh) 47.4; 
    Minimum battery capacity (Wh) 45.8,
  • External features – Housing: Aluminum, Keyboard with power and volume buttons,
  • Color versions – Platinum with palm rest covered with Alcantara fabric, Matte black with metal palm rest,
  • Dimensions – 308 mm x 223 mm x 14.5 mm,
  • Weight – Surface Laptop 4 13.5 “in platinum colors with Alcantara fabric: 1265 g; 
    Surface Laptop 4 13.5 “in matte black with a metallic finish: 1288 g,
  • Software – Windows 10 Home 20H2 operating system,
  • Warranty – One-year limited hardware warranty.

Design

Surface Laptop 4 is very aesthetic equipment. Just like a few years ago, Microsoft tried to make everything painfully angular, which in a way corresponding to the style of Windows 10, now the ubiquitous rectangles and squares – regardless of where they appear in the notebook casing – are mitigated by rounding the corners and milling the edges.

In fact, the only places where we see lines that meet at right angles are—the shiny Microsoft logo on the device’s cover and the edges of the screen itself. And although in every other element, we still deal with an almost sterile design, the whole thing makes a perfect impression.

Surface Laptop 4 looks great both on a home desk and on a table during a business meeting. We have one of the cleanest styles in the industry – no unnecessary embellishments, no embossing, unsightly lettering, or asymmetrical ornaments. It’s almost a little work of art.

Microsoft clearly does not want to make its laptop a multimedia combine to connect dozens of home appliances. Whenever possible, we should use wireless accessories as much as possible and minimize the number of connected cables to the notebook. After all, it would disturb the appearance of the equipment. It is enough to look at the promotional materials of Surface Laptop 4 to realize that minimalism is completely intentional in this case.

After opening the flap, it immediately becomes clear that Microsoft has not yet learned to shrink the bezels around the screen. Indeed, they are not extremely thick, but looking at what the competition can do with ~ 14-inch notebooks, there is a feeling of a certain insufficiency.

The base of the laptop itself looks really decent. Although the keyboard does not extend from edge to edge and leaves a bit of space on the sides, it does not seem to be stuck in a hurry, too small or too large – it has been integrated quite neatly into the whole and does not spoil the layout of the elements in any way. The same is with the touchpad, although it could be a bit larger.

Surface Laptop 4 is available in two color versions: black and gray, but only the latter (called platinum by Microsoft) has Alcantara as a palm rest padding. It is certainly a convenient and pleasant to use solution. However, numerous reports and photos of used Surfaces in which this material occurs suggest that it may not wear out elegantly.

Display

In many areas, Microsoft, compared to Surface Laptop 3, decided to change the entire look. This applies to the screen, for example. The panel used is still the same, combat-tested 13.5-inch IPS matrix, displaying the image at a resolution of 2256 x 1504 pixels. The colors it presents are charming, close to nature, and the viewing angles are excellent.

The specificity of Surface Laptop 4, as a device with a touch display, forces the manufacturer to use a glare screen, which will collect our fingerprints and quite strongly reflect the image of the surroundings. It is all the more visible in, the brighter the conditions we work. So while the high brightness of the screen, reaching 420 nits, is more than sufficient for using the notebook outside the home, at the same time, you have to get used to the fact that reflections will additionally work against the readability of the screen.

When sitting with a laptop at a desk or holding it on your lap, the range of motion of the screen is sufficient. However, a big plus is a keyboard, which is considered one of the most comfortable in modern notebooks. The 1.3mm key travel is nice, modifier keys like Ctrl or Shift are practically found by default, and Alt – though not wider than the regular letter keys – is not lost when creating texts. The Caps Lock and Function (Fn) keys have white indicators so you can see if they’re active at a glance.

There is also a trackpad under the keyboard that you can use with pleasure. Thanks to the fact that it uses a mat of glass, not plastic, the finger glides on its surface practically alone. All gestures from Windows 10 are read flawlessly, and the click of the keys at the bottom of the touchpad is pleasantly muffled, although it has the right pitch and “feedback.”

Surface Laptop 4 turned out to be the perfect equipment for watching movies – not only thanks to the excellent screen but also very nice speakers with Dolby Atmos. Innovation is the placement of the pickups under the keyboard – the sound comes from the backspace and tilde area. It would seem that such a procedure would unnecessarily muffle the emission of sound and make it “boxy.” Fortunately, the speakers seem to have ample room to operate.

Even when set to maximum power, they do not bother you with unwanted vibrations and wheezing. Right next to the loudspeakers, the decibels reach 80, and from the distance of the laptop placed in front of us on the desk or our knees, the sound of about 60 dB will reach our ears. This is more than enough to enjoy music in the room or the right volume in movies. It is worth making sure that we have all Windows 10 updates from Microsoft installed – at the beginning of the tests, the DACs could crackle when changing the volume level,

Performance

Microsoft doesn’t think of calling its laptop a gaming laptop or portraying it as a machine built to break performance records. Even the description on the website describes Surface Laptop 4 as a device designed to work with documents and provide high-level entertainment—only this and so much. Therefore, when subjecting the device to criticism, especially in terms of the price-performance ratio, it is worth remembering.

SSD speed in both read and write fine, but it doesn’t stand out from other ultrabooks in any way. Evidently, Microsoft did not go here with the most expensive components, although it is interesting to equip the basic version with an Intel processor with a 512 GB SSD drive.

The Intel Iris graphics are a significant leap in quality compared to the systems integrated with the low-voltage Ice Lakes but still providing a fundamental gaming experience. For the price of the Surface Laptop 4, we can easily get a gaming notebook that will fire the latest games in great detail – the owner of a Surface Laptop can only dream about it.

It’s not, however, that Microsoft’s notebook is only suitable for running Solitaire. In fact, games for a few years will work quite well on it. The old GRID 2 still hasn’t finished flashes at maximum resolution and maximum graphics settings at 40-50 fps. If we do not despise the occasional match in Fortnite or another battle royale, we will also have no grounds to complain about performance. Sure, the number of frames per second will not be measured in hundreds, but it will be easy to fight for a win.

Connectivity

The set of ports in Surface Laptop 4 is not very extensive. Most users would not despise the additional USB-C port, especially since it could easily be squeezed next to or even instead of the Surface Connector. The lack of support for Thunderbolt 4 is also still incomprehensible. Microsoft is apparently not yet ready to introduce this standard to its devices, which is a pity because Surface Laptop 4 is the equivalent of the Apple MacBook Air in the Windows world.

Microsoft Surface Laptop 4 Right Port Microsoft Surface Laptop 4 Left Port

As for the operation of the wireless modules, The presence of Wi-Fi 6 and Bluetooth 5, communication with each connected equipment was hassle-free, and you have to remember that in Microsoft’s history, it happened that Surfaces had difficulty maintaining the status of a paired device, even when it was a dedicated accessory. In this case, nothing like that happened – we will not find any scratches on this glass.

It is also worth having a word about the front camera. The camera itself does not have a matrix with too high a resolution. The transmitted image or recorded videos will have a maximum resolution of 720p, which is visible. Microsoft absolutely consciously placed a lower-quality camera than, for example, the one used in Surface Pro 6. This does not mean that we will look lame at Zoom or Teams, but there is a good chance that there will be someone with a better built-in webcam at the videoconference. The captured sound quality is outstanding – the interlocutors during calls always heard me clearly and clearly.

There is no fingerprint reader in Surface Laptop 4. Still, the security filter is a sensor located next to the camera lens, which allows you to log in to the system using the Windows Hello function. Thanks to the infrared scanning of our faces, unlocking the screen literally takes a moment, regardless of the lighting conditions.

Battery

Microsoft is very pleased with what has been achieved with the new Surface Laptop 4 in terms of battery efficiency. And must admit that we are actually dealing with decent working times on a single battery charge. Of course, the results obtained during everyday use did not come close to those declared by the manufacturer. Still, it should also be noted that the patterns of using the equipment in my case “tighten” the processor and memory of the device – and these are components that consume a lot of energy.

After adding the screen backlight less than 60%, you will get battery times significantly different from the 17 hours mentioned by Microsoft. Such records have been beaten while limiting screen backlighting and limiting low-resource operations, such as when playing back movies.

Other usage patterns are, for example, 3 hours 30 minutes (2.5 hours of Zoom conference, 1 hour of play) or 2 hours of gaming from the 100% to 5% charge indicator. With a less battery-consuming backlight, for example, using your notebook only to watch movies in the evening, you can dial up usage times of more than 10 hours. Really good!

Certainly, an advantage will be the ability to charge the battery fairly quickly – one and a half hours is enough to indicate 100% of the battery. For this, we need a Microsoft 65 W charger with a Surface Connect connector included in the set. Optionally, you can try charging via the USB-C port.

The charger itself also has a USB-A port, thanks to which we can replenish the energy, let’s say, in a mobile device that we have with us. Microsoft has been keeping this trifle in chargers for all kinds of Surface for years, and it must be said that it is a very nice accessory that I have used more than once to recharge smaller gadgets while traveling.

Conclusion!

Surface Laptop 4 is a great example of how Microsoft approaches the production of consumer electronics. Great emphasis is placed on the purity of style, high-quality materials, and performance.

The company has created a laptop to be used for work and entertainment. For this purpose, he installed a fabulous touchscreen and outstanding speakers in his notebook. At the same time, it is not a universal notebook – he will be sad if he stays on his desk for eternity with a charger connected to it and a hundred cables for our audio-video set.

It is a bit more mobile, convenient to carry from place to place. It shines among other ultrabooks with impeccable style and is one of the best-in-class keyboards that really encourages typing. And thanks to the use of the latest Intel processors, you can enjoy a smooth system while maintaining a high work culture and even occasionally pop into an older game. And all this while maintaining quite good working times for a relatively small device with a 13-inch screen.

Surface Laptop 4 are not due to shortcomings or omissions – Microsoft gave users exactly the equipment they wanted. So we do not have an HDMI port or Thunderbolt 4. It is difficult to find more deficiencies here because we are dealing with a really nice device.
